BV03 AMX is a 2003 Skoda Fabia in Silver with a 1,397c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.
Across all 2003 Skoda Fabia models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.1% with a typical mileage of 65,642 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Skoda Fabia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,456 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BV03 AMX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Fabia typ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Skoda Fabia is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
